http://history.absoluteelsewhere.net/January/january4.htmlEvans, Mal


In the early and mid-sixties M.E. was a roadie for the Beatles. Mal invited Bill Collins to a Beatles recording session in 1967; this led to that Paul McCartney got interested in hearing The Iveys. In 1968 Mal Evans brought a tape of Iveys recordings to the Apple offices and both Derek Taylor and Paul McCartney were impressed them. The Story of How Mal Evans had to drive from the south (Beatles in back) up to Liverpool in freezing conditions, with the front window smashed out ( a stone cracked the glass, and Mal then had to smash it all out) ... only knowing where he was driving by looking at the edge of the road.
